Understanding Door Hinges

Door hinges are mechanical devices that connect a door to its frame, permitting it to swing open and close. There are numerous types of hinges, each designed for specific door types and functions:

Type of HingeDescriptionCommon Uses
Butt HingeA basic hinge with 2 plates connected by a pin.Interior doors
Continuous HingeLikewise called a piano hinge, it runs the whole length of the door.Heavy doors, piano covers
Concealed HingeHidden when the door is closed for a tidy appearance.Cabinets, modern-day doors
Pivot HingePermits the door to pivot on a single point at the top and bottom.Heavy or oversized doors
Spring HingeContains a spring system for automatic closing.Screen doors, gates

Typical Door Hinge Problems

Although durable, door hinges can experience several problems with time. Understanding these issues can help house owners recognize when to look for professional repair services. Here are some typical concerns associated with door hinges:

  1. Squeaking Noises: A typical grievance, frequently triggered by lack of lubrication.
  2. Rust and Corrosion: Metal hinges can rust when exposed to wetness, leading to their breakdown.
  3. Misalignment: Over time, doors might droop or misalign triggering gaps, which can be associated to worn-out hinges or inappropriate installation.
  4. Stiff Motion: Hinges might end up being stiff due to dirt build-up or absence of lubrication, making doors hard to open or close.
  5. Broken Pins: The pin holding the hinge together can break, rendering the door non-functional.
  6. Loose Screws: Screws can become loose with time, resulting in hinges not being secure and potentially causing the door to come off its hinges.

Steps in the Door Hinge Repair Process

When experiencing issues with door hinges, the best strategy is frequently to work with a professional repair service. Here's what the repair procedure typically entails:

  1. Assessment of the Problem: A technician will examine the door and hinges to determine the nature of the concern.
  2. Elimination of the Hinges: In cases of serious damage, the technician might need to remove hinges for replacement or repair.
  3. Lubrication: If squeaking or stiffness is the issue, lubing the hinges with the proper oil may fix the issue.
  4. Alignment Adjustment: For misaligned doors, modifications might be made to the hinges or door frame.
  5. Replacement of Damaged Parts: Broken pins, screws, and even entire hinges might require to be replaced.
  6. Reinstallation and Testing: After repairs or replacements, the hinges are reinstalled, and the door is tested for proper function.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How frequently should I lube my door hinges?

It depends upon the usage and environment. A standard suggestion is to lube door hinges every 6 months to a year.

2. Can I repair a damaged hinge myself?

Small issues, such as lubrication or tightening loose screws, can typically be handled by property owners. Nevertheless, for more serious issues like misalignment or damaged hinges, professional support is advised.

3. What kind of lubricant should I use for my hinges?

Silicone spray is typically the best choice for oiling door hinges, as it is waterproof and minimizes dust build-up. Prevent using WD-40 as a long-term lube.
